We aim to run the Jams from 10am to 2pm on the second Saturday of the month, alternating between venues in the Redruth/Pool/Camborne area and the Bodmin area.

The Jams are for anyone who’s interested in computing and technology. All ages are welcome to attend to, from beginners to experts, to ask any questions or learn about programming and how to interface computers to the physical world.

We have a number of Raspberry Pi computers enabling you to experiment with and learn how to:

Program in Minecraft
Control traffic lights with Python and Scratch
Compose music with Sonic Pi
Use the Raspberry Pi camera to take pictures and record video
Program robots

We’re more than happy to help with any questions you might have or support that you require. From advice on how to get started through to problems you are having with your programs, hardware or computer.

We’d also love to see projects that you are working on, so please bring them along and let us see what you’ve been up to.
